A discussion of the adsorption of inorganics from aqueous solution on inorganic adsorbents. It emphasizes the relationship between adsorption and surface charging, highlighting simple and complex adsorption systems sorted by the adsorbent as well as the adsorbate. The author includes a comprehensive collection of pristine PZC of different materials - covering crystallographic structure, methods of preparation, impurities in the solid, temperature and ionic composition of the solution, experimental methods to determine PZC, and the correlation between zero points and other physical quantities.

Physical properties of adsorbents; surface charging in absence of strongly adsorbing species; strongly adsorbing species; adsorption modelling; sorption properties of selected organic materials. Appendices: abbreviations; index of trade names, trademarks and manufacturers.
